cmd/compile: make jump table symbol static

The jump table symbol is accessed only from the function symbol
(in the same package), so it can be static. Also, if the function
is DUPOK and it is, somehow, compiled differently in two different
packages, the linker must choose the jump table symbol associated
to the function symbol it chose. Currently the jump table symbol
is DUPOK, so that is not guaranteed. Making it static will
guarantee that, as each copy of the function symbol refers to its
own jump table symbol.

@ -2131,8 +2131,8 @@ func logicFlags32(x int32) flagConstant {
func makeJumpTableSym(b *Block) *obj.LSym {
s := base.Ctxt.Lookup(fmt.Sprintf("%s.jump%d", b.Func.fe.Func().LSym.Name, b.ID))
s.Set(obj.AttrDuplicateOK, true)
s.Set(obj.AttrLocal, true)
// The jump table symbol is accessed only from the function symbol.
s.Set(obj.AttrStatic, true)
return s
}
